Sarah Palin's Juneau Neighbors Support Barack Obama

500_Obama_supporters.jpg Sarah Palin might have an 80% approval rating among Alaskans and be the Republican Party's shiny new sex object, but she isn't so liked by her neighbors—well the ones over in Juneau near the tanning bed stocked Governor's Mansion. According to this photographer, "All the houses surrounding Sarah Palin's mansion have Obama signs." As you can see by the photo, a next door neighbor took things up a notch and painted a message of support for the presidential candidate right on their windows. Apparently Palin is way more popular in her hometown of Wasilla, a willing recipient of all those lovely earmarks, that 'other' $600 million bridge to nowhere, and where she gets to charge money for living in her own house.
